Output 43a55db029e38d11f9f08034b66d05aed411bbf356f60c632549cb30979e410e:0

value
10485586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b0626391cbbb205f615e3f4b93b94035751c4f7 OP_EQUAL
address
3EN7DUCBpzPEAKJACDNGE2UGxUpNpA4iS6
transaction
43a55db029e38d11f9f08034b66d05aed411bbf356f60c632549cb30979e410e
spent
true